Patricia Eiduka Continues Strong Performance in Tour de Ski, Secures 37th Place in Latest Stage
Latvian cross-country skier Patricia Eiduka achieved a commendable 37th place finish in the latest stage of the prestigious Tour de Ski, a five-kilometer freestyle event. The race saw a victory for American Jessie Diggins, showcasing the high level of competition within the event. This result follows a series of consistent performances for Eiduka throughout the Tour.
The Tour de Ski is renowned as one of the most grueling events on the cross-country skiing calendar, testing athletes’ endurance, technique, and mental fortitude.
